<h2>History of this Database Engine</h2>
The development of H2 was started in May 2004,
but it was first published on December 14th 2005.
The author of H2, Thomas Mueller, is also the original developer of Hypersonic SQL.
In 2001, he joined PointBase Inc. where he created PointBase Micro.
At that point, he had to discontinue Hypersonic SQL, but then the HSQLDB Group was formed
to continued to work on the Hypersonic SQL codebase.
The name H2 stands for Hypersonic 2; however H2 does not share any code with
Hypersonic SQL or HSQLDB. H2 is built from scratch.

1116 1117 1118 1119 1120
    After finding that HSQLDB was faster in the PolePosition test, and unsuccessful tries to
    improve the performance of H2 even more, the reason is finally found: H2 always closed
    the database when closing the last connection, but HSQLDB leaves the database open.
    This also explains OutOfMemory problems when testing multiple databases with PolePosition.
    But leaving the database open is a useful feature for some applications.
